云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

1. **C# 基礎知識**:
- 數(shù)據(jù)類型(值類型、引用類型)
- 控制結構(if、switch、循環(huán))
- 類與對象(成員變量、成員方法、構造函數(shù)、析構函數(shù))
- 繼承與多態(tài)(派生類、基類、虛方法、抽象類、接口)
- 委托與事件(委托、事件、事件處理程序)
2. **.NET 框架基礎**:
- .NET 框架概述(CLR、CTS、CLS)
- .NET 類庫(System 命名空間常用類)
- 異常處理(try-catch-finally 塊、異常類)
- 文件與流操作(File 類、Stream 類)
- 集合與泛型(List、Dictionary 等)
3. **ASP.NET 基礎**:
- Web 窗體(Page 類、控件、事件)
- 數(shù)據(jù)綁定(DataSource 控件、數(shù)據(jù)綁定表達式)
- 狀態(tài)管理(ViewState、Session、Cookie)
- 身份驗證與授權(Forms 身份驗證、角色管理)
- 配置管理(Web.config 文件、應用程序配置)
4. **數(shù)據(jù)庫操作**:
- ADO.NET(Connection、Command、DataReader、DataSet)
- 實體框架(Entity Framework,ORM 工具)
- 數(shù)據(jù)庫連接字符串(SQL Server、MySQL 等)
- 數(shù)據(jù)庫查詢與更新(SQL 語句、存儲過程)
5. **軟件開發(fā)基礎**:
- 軟件生命周期(分析、設計、實現(xiàn)、測試、部署)
- 軟件設計模式(MVC、單例模式、工廠模式等)
- 版本控制(Git、SVN 等)
- 單元測試(MSTest、NUnit 等)
- 性能優(yōu)化(代碼優(yōu)化、數(shù)據(jù)庫優(yōu)化)
以上這些特性是初入.NET 開發(fā)領域必備的基礎知識,可以幫助你理解.NET 生態(tài)系統(tǒng),并為進一步學習和實踐打下堅實的基礎。隨著經(jīng)驗的積累,你還可以深入學習更高級的主題,如ASP.NET MVC、Web API、WCF、Windows Forms、WPF 等。